CreditMigrator is a developer/operations tool built specifically for Shopify Store Credit migration. Its main use case is bulk-importing customers’ store credit into Shopify via CSV, or deducting from existing credit balances. It is not a general-purpose ETL platform; instead, it wraps a narrow Shopify credit-migration workflow into a structured process.
The tool supports bulk CSV imports of thousands of credit records. Its field requirements are clearly defined: at least one of Customer ID, Email, or Phone is required, along with fields such as Credit Amount, Debit Amount, Currency, Reason, and Expiration Date. It provides a mandatory Dry Run and validation mechanism to catch formatting and business-logic errors before the actual migration. If the network or server is interrupted, the process automatically pauses and can later resume from the breakpoint, helping avoid duplicate writes. Migrations can also be manually paused or canceled, and canceling does not affect existing data. Its reporting features are practical: after completion, failure, or cancellation, users can download detailed CSV reports showing successful rows, failed rows, and validation errors.
The page lists a Growth Plan at $50/month, billed monthly, with unlimited CSV imports and no hidden fees. It also mentions “Subscribe yearly,” but no annual pricing is provided. As for limitations, the currency must exactly match the Shopify store’s primary currency, and amounts must be greater than zero. Each customer can receive a maximum transfer of $15,000 or the equivalent amount, and debits cannot exceed the current balance.
The main advantages are its focused feature set and relatively complete migration-safety mechanisms, making it suitable for bulk operations that require rollback-style safeguards and audit reports. The FAQ explains CSV structure, expiration dates, debit logic, and common errors clearly, which lowers the learning curve. The downside is its very narrow scope: only Shopify-related functionality is visible. There is no disclosed API/SDK, open-source option, self-hosting support, permission model, payment method, or SLA, so technical teams should verify these points before purchasing.
CreditMigrator is suitable for merchants, implementation consultants, and operations teams migrating to Shopify or needing to bulk import or correct customer Store Credit. If you only need to make a small number of manual adjustments, a subscription may not be necessary. The page does not provide information about access from China, so it should be tested directly; payment methods are also not disclosed. Alternatives include manual processing in the Shopify admin, import tools such as Matrixify combined with custom workflows, or building an in-house Shopify app.
